Intel Pentium Gold G7400T: Complete Technical Analysis

Executive Summary

The Intel Pentium Gold G7400T is a low-power variant of the Pentium Gold G7400 desktop processor, featuring 2 cores and 4 threads within a constrained 35W Thermal Design Power (TDP). With a fixed clock speed of 3.1GHz, this processor is engineered for energy-efficient systems that require basic computing performance with improved multitasking capabilities through Hyper-Threading technology. The inclusion of Intel UHD Graphics 710 makes it suitable for compact builds without discrete graphics cards. While its performance is limited by its power envelope, the G7400T offers enhanced efficiency and multitasking for small form factor systems, digital signage, and office workstations where silence and minimal power draw are prioritized.

Final Verdict

The Intel Pentium Gold G7400T occupies a specialized niche in the processor market, delivering improved multitasking performance over Celeron models within a strict 35W power envelope. It represents an efficiency-oriented entry-level processor with Hyper-Threading technology, offering better performance for its power class than Celeron T-series parts. While its performance cannot match standard TDP parts, its low heat output and integrated graphics make it ideal for compact, silent, and energy-efficient systems requiring basic multitasking capabilities. For builders prioritizing minimal power consumption with improved multitasking over Celeron, the G7400T is a suitable choice.
